Transaction 763e6421770093e4e7c6e26c5bc41c9684a6ac8b3b4bc4910f655d0d7fa1262b

1 Input
1 Outputs
  • 763e6421770093e4e7c6e26c5bc41c9684a6ac8b3b4bc4910f655d0d7fa1262b:0
  • value  1214126
    address  3Cu719q2g7qa5XrNdJyPWnSojDtdxeTv8W